Contemporary Management Approaches: Navigating the Modern Business Landscape

In today's rapidly evolving business world, effective management is paramount to organizational success. Contemporary management approaches embrace innovation, data-driven decision-making, and a focus on employee well-being and sustainability to meet the challenges of the 21st century.

Globalization, Innovation, and Technology: The Drivers of Transformation

Globalization has created a dynamic and interconnected business environment. Companies must adapt to diverse markets, cultural nuances, and technological advancements. Innovation is the lifeblood of modern organizations, driving efficiency, productivity, and competitive advantage. Technology serves as a catalyst for innovation, enabling businesses to streamline operations, enhance customer experiences, and harness the power of big data.

Evidence-based Management: Making Decisions with Confidence

Data analytics and research are essential tools for contemporary managers. Evidence-based management involves basing decisions on empirical evidence, ensuring objectivity and informed decision-making. It promotes data-driven insights, allowing organizations to measure performance, identify patterns, and optimize outcomes.

Agile Management: Empowering Teams for Success

Traditional management models often fall short in fast-paced, complex environments. Agile management, such as Scrum, Kanban, and lean manufacturing, emphasizes flexibility, responsiveness, and team collaboration. Agile methodologies break down projects into manageable chunks, allowing teams to adapt quickly to changing requirements and deliver value in iterative sprints.

Design Thinking: Human-Centered Solutions

Design thinking is a problem-solving methodology that puts the user experience front and center. It involves empathizing with end-users, prototyping potential solutions, and iteratively testing and refining designs. Design thinking fosters innovation and helps organizations create products and services that meet the real needs of their customers.

Servant Leadership: Empowering Employees to Excel

Servant leadership is a leadership style that focuses on empowering employees and fostering a collaborative and supportive work environment. Servant leaders prioritize the welfare of their team, creating a culture of trust, open communication, and personal growth. By delegating decision-making authority and providing feedback, servant leaders unleash the potential of their workforce and cultivate a highly engaged and motivated organization.

Positive Psychology: Nurturing a Thriving Workplace

Positive psychology is a field that studies the psychological factors that contribute to well-being and resilience. Contemporary managers recognize the importance of employee well-being and create positive and supportive work environments. They promote optimism, resilience, and strength-based approaches to enhance employee engagement, creativity, and productivity.

Sustainability Management: Balancing Profit with Purpose

Sustainability management goes beyond environmental protection to encompass social and economic responsibility. Sustainable organizations embrace ethical business practices, reduce their ecological footprint, and actively engage with stakeholders to create positive social and environmental impact. By balancing profit with purpose, organizations can build a sustainable competitive advantage and foster trust with consumers and investors.

Big Data and Analytics: Unlocking Competitive Advantage

The proliferation of digital technologies and data has given rise to big data. Data mining, machine learning, and business intelligence enable organizations to extract meaningful insights from vast amounts of data. By harnessing the power of big data, businesses can optimize operations, target marketing campaigns, and gain a competitive edge through data-driven decision-making.

Artificial Intelligence (AI): The Future of Work

Artificial intelligence (AI) is rapidly transforming business practices. Machine learning, natural language processing, and computer vision empower organizations to automate processes, enhance decision-making, and improve customer experiences. AI has the potential to revolutionize industries, create new opportunities, and augment human capabilities.

Ethics and Corporate Responsibility: The Foundation of Trust

Strong ethical principles and corporate responsibility are essential for building trust and maintaining a positive reputation in today's interconnected world. Contemporary management embraces business ethics and actively promotes transparency, accountability, and a commitment to doing what is right. Ethical behavior and social responsibility not only create a positive work environment but also strengthen relationships with stakeholders and foster long-term business success.

Benefits and Challenges of Contemporary Management Approaches

The adoption of contemporary management approaches offers numerous benefits for businesses. Globalization, innovation, technology facilitate expansion into new markets, foster innovation, and enhance operational efficiency. Evidence-based management promotes informed decision-making by leveraging data and metrics to measure performance. Agile management fosters flexibility and responsiveness, enabling organizations to adapt swiftly to changing market dynamics.

However, these approaches also present certain challenges. Globalization can increase competition, and cultural differences can hinder effective management. Innovation and technology require significant investment and can lead to skill shortages. Evidence-based management relies on data availability and analysis capabilities, which may be limited. Agile management can be disruptive, especially in traditional organizations.

Design thinking emphasizes user experience and iteration, leading to products and services that meet customer needs. Servant leadership empowers employees and fosters collaboration, improving employee engagement and job satisfaction. Positive psychology promotes resilience and well-being in the workplace, reducing stress and boosting productivity.

Yet, design thinking can be time-consuming, and its iterative nature may delay decision-making. Servant leadership requires a shift in mindset and can be difficult to implement in hierarchical organizations. Positive psychology faces challenges in measuring its impact and integrating it into daily operations.

Sustainability management promotes environmental and social responsibility, mitigating risks and enhancing brand reputation. Big data and analytics extract valuable insights from data, enabling better decision-making and competitive advantage. Artificial intelligence automates tasks, improves efficiency, and enhances predictions.

However, sustainability management can increase costs and require significant organizational change. Big data requires skilled analysts and robust infrastructure. Artificial intelligence raises ethical concerns and the potential for bias.

Finally, ethics and corporate responsibility emphasize integrity and transparency in management. This approach builds trust with stakeholders and enhances organizational reputation. Nonetheless, maintaining ethical conduct can be challenging in competitive markets, and corporate responsibility can conflict with profit maximization.

In conclusion, contemporary management approaches offer significant benefits but also present challenges. By carefully considering the advantages and limitations of each approach, organizations can tailor their management practices to achieve their strategic goals and effectively navigate the dynamic business landscape.
